Recipe Recommendations
- milk 105 grams
- whole egg liquid 110 grams
- sugar 45 grams
- salt 5 grams
- bread flour 300 grams
- yeast 5 grams
- butter 100 grams
- wine-stained raisins 100 grams
- egg liquid appropriate amount
- almond slices appropriate amount
- powdered sugar appropriate amount
